1.1. IMAGES purpose.1. IMAGES purpose

IMAGES has been initiated to respond to the challenge of understanding the mechanisms and consequences of climatic changes using oceanic sedimentary records. Climatic mechanisms must be studied at global scale using sophisticated models based on high quality data that represent the variability of surface and deep ocean physical and chemical characteristics during key periods of recent earth history. Individual research is no longer sufficient to resolve this problem because the acquisition of the required, long sediment cores in high sedimentation rate areas is expensive, and the proper study of such cores demands the use of multiple tools and large numbers of measurements.

IMAGES has been built as an international effort for the marine sediment research of PAGES-IGBP, with the support of SCOR. The major goal of IMAGES is to foster co-ordination, at the international level, of scientific programs that address the scientific goals outlined in the IMAGES “Science and Implementation Plan”. Operational support, based on specific scientific proposals, is sought from national or international scientific agencies.

1.2. Scientific objectives

The overriding IMAGES science issue is to quantify climate and chemical variability of the ocean on time scales of oceanic and cryospheric processes; to determine its sensitivity to identified internal and external forcings, and to determine its role in controlling atmospheric CO2.

In order to achieve these scientific objectives, IMAGES proposes to co-ordinate a global program to collect and study marine sediment records to address three fundamental questions:

How have changes in surface ocean properties controlled the evolution of global heat transfer through the deep and surface ocean and thereby modified climate ?
How have changes in ocean circulation, ocean chemistry, and biological activity interacted to generate the observed record of atmospheric pCO2 over the past 900 kyr ?
How closely has continental climate linked to ocean surface and deep water properties ?

2.2. Facilities and drilling requirement - ODP-IMAGES relationships

The major scientific issues presented above can only be achieved through the examination of the records preserved in ocean sediments. At least 30 dedicated oceanographic expeditions will be necessary over the next decade to collect appropriate sediment samples and supporting data. In order to obtain the necessary temporal resolution for IMAGES objectives, one will have to sample in regions of the ocean where sedimentation rates are of the order or higher than 10 cm/kyr. This, combined with the necessity for 300,000 year or longer records, requires core lengths of no less than 15 meters. For many areas, core lengths of at least 30 m and as great as 50 to 75 m will be necessary. Most coring platforms available can only retrieve cores that are less than about 20 m in length. The French R/V Marion Dufresne is presently the only ship which is able routinely to retrieve piston cores of 30 to 50 m length. IMAGES will rely on (and advise) the Ocean Drilling Program for the acquisition of longer sedimentary sequences (50 to 250 m) which are necessary to study both very high sedimentation rates areas (50 cm/kyr and more) and longer time series.

Several platforms permitting sediment coring of several tens of meters will be necessary to implement IMAGES on a global basis. Some ships may be available for long coring (around 30 m in length) after small or large modifications of their structure have been made.
Technical working groups will be initiated both at national and international levels to study the feasibility of “mobile coring packages” (winch, cable and giant corer) which can be adapted on specific large ocean going vessels from the international community.

  1. METHODOLOGIES

3.1. Site survey and coring

The major requirement of the project is the availability of long sediment cores. High resolution seismic imaging of the upper 50-300 m of the sedimentary cover as well as sea floor mapping techniques are required to locate good quality coring sites efficiently. Additional data should include hydrographic profiles, including CTD and near-bottom water samples.

3.3. Chronology and stratigraphy

Stratigraphy and chronology will require that important efforts should be devoted to the acquisition of high-resolution d18O records. Furthermore, recent development in the acquisition of near-continuous records of sediment physical properties (e.g. density, remnant magnetic intensity, colour reflectance) are very promising in the development of high resolution chronostratigraphy (down to centuries).

Absolute dating of key periods is mandatory. More AMS 14C analyses of foraminifera are necessary for precise dating of the oceanic history over the last 40 kyr. Other material may be dated and correlated within paleoceanographic records : U/Th of corals (sea level), K/Ar of volcanic material (tephrochronology). They should allow a progressive extension of the absolute time scale over the last several thousand years.
It is also essential to develop improved methods to correlate ocean-, continent-, and ice paleo-records together.

4.3. Access to IMAGES cores and data

Cruise participants and related scientists (e.g. shore-based scientists active in the planning of specific cruises) will have a two-year period of exclusive access to the samples and data collected in IMAGES operations. The data will be made available to the whole scientific community at the end of that two-year period.
Scientists conducting an IMAGES-related research project will have an additional period of three years of privileged access to the sediment cores and samples collected under the responsibility of IMAGES partners and archived under IMAGES guidelines. After this period, an open access policy is encouraged. In addition, IMAGES, in the interest of international co-operation, strongly encourages IMAGES partners to have a policy of open access to all sediment archives within their institutional control.

WG1 - North Atlantic Ultra High Resolution

Chair: E. Jansen. WG1 focused on the preparation of the Marion Dufresne 1999 cruise in North Atlantic, Labrador Sea, Norwegian Sea, and numerous fjords and estuaries along the track. The main target was to obtain giant cores in high accumulation rate sediments, if possible with annual varves, at about 100 stations along two general meridional transect in the Eastern and Western margins of the northern Atlantic and Nordic seas. This was the major operation for IMAGES in 99: a three months cruise, with USA, Norway, France, Iceland, Germany, the Netherlands, Denmark, Canada, UK, Sweden as participants.

WG6 - Terminal Millenial Synthesis of Decadal-to-Millenial-Scale Climate Records of the last 80 kyr

Chairs: M. Sarnthein and J. P. Kennett. The objectives and goals of this working group are i) to create a common canonical time series of short-term and abrupt climatic events documented in marine sediment records; ii) to tie the ultrahigh-resolution marine climate records to ice core and other varved records of climate change measured on calendar-year time scale; iii) to constrain the temporal and spatial variability of both the oceanic C14-reservoir effect and cosmogenic C14 production to develop C14 as a high-precision tracer in palaeoceanography and to improve chronological resolution in sediment records; iv) to better understand teleconnection processes in global transfer of climatic change; v) to prepare co-operative SCOR-PAGES / IMAGES workshop within one year of inception and to publish a special volume on its results as IGBP product.

A meeting was held involving more than 50 top scientists at the SCOR-IMAGES Workshop in Trins, Austria, February 16-19, 2000. A summary article was published in Eos.

WG8 - Ice–Ocean Interaction

The Ice-Ocean interaction working group was established in order to bring together researchers from various fields interested in the dynamic interaction between ice/ice sheets and ocean circulation. The justfication for establishing the WG lies in the many unresolved questions regarding triggering and amplification of rapid climate changes during which ice sheets and ocean circulation undergo drastic changes. It was felt that the solution lies in a better interaction between paleoceanographers, petrologists working on provenance studies, sedimentologists, glacial geologists, glaciologists and modellers.

This WG chaired by John Andrews, Boulder, USA and Eystein Jansen, Bergen, Norway was established by Images in 2001.

WG10 - Reconstruction of Past Ocean Circulation - PACE (SCOR-WG 123)

This joint IMAGES/SCOR working group will

Assess the existing paleoceanographic methods for reconstructing the history of ocean circulation over the past 120,000 years. Are the existing methods sufficient for a robust reconstruction of past ocean circulation? Are existing chronological tools sufficient to reconstruct distinct ocean circulation states? If not, what developments are necessary?
Assess the available paleoceanographic data for reconstructing the history of ocean circulation over the past 120,000 years.Can robust conclusions on past ocean circulation be drawn from existing data? For what time periods and locations?
Develop recommendations for future approaches to quantitatively assess the hypothesised changes in ocean circulation over the same time scale.
Identify a minimum array of global locations and data types that would help to constrain uncertainties concerning changes in ocean circulation linked to major climate changes, bearing in mind the potential for collecting appropriate geological material as well as the size of the expected circulation signal relative to uncertainties in the methods. Through international co-operation within the IMAGES and ODP, existing cores would be identified and plans for new coring to meet these objectives would be discussed.
This plan will outline a coordinated international project which we will refer to as the Palocean Circulation Experiment (PACE).

WG11 - Links Between Present Oceanic Processes and Paleo-Records

Another SCOR/IMAGES working group arises from the Paleo-JGOFS Task Team (PJTT) with the following objectives:

improve the collaboration between the two core projects
identify regions of specific interest for future research
propagate these issues into the next phase of IGBP II ocean research programs.
The main objective of the proposed working group is to combine new insights gained from the study of modern biogeochemical processes and ecosystem dynamics, with paleoceanographic studies aiming to improve our understanding of past oceanic processes. In turn, accurate interpretation of the sedimentary record extends the temporal baseline of observation, thus allowing to better gauge the impact of anthropogenic disturbances against natural variability. To achieve this unifying vision, the working group will:

Use the new insights gained from contemporary ocean biogeochemical studies to identify or refine our understanding of key oceanic processes and develop or improve proxies for these processes for subsequent use in paleoceanographic studies.
Refine established proxies, provide mechanistic understanding and foster the development of new proxies within integrated multidisciplinary studies in the modern ocean.
Use proxy evidence from the sedimentary records to test hypotheses of the oceanic response to climate change.

Cruise Schedule

The acquisition of long sediment cores in high sedimentation rate areas is a major task of the IMAGES program.
IMAGES co-ordinates the preparation of cruises on board the French vessel Marion Dufresne, which has unique facilities for giant coring cruises.
